Key Applications

Pharmaceutical Intermediates

Used in the synthesis of active pharmaceutical ingredients (APIs) for drugs like Buclizine HCl and various antiallergic medications, contributing to the development of new treatments.

Agrochemical Intermediates

Serves as a crucial precursor in the production of acaricides and other pesticides, playing a key role in crop protection and enhancing agricultural yields, supporting effective pesticide synthesis.
